Description
Laser quenching and application of wear-resistant powder to the cutting edge of a hob is considered, with careful positioning of the laser spot. Experimental data are analyzed. The quality of quenching and powder surfacing depends on the machining conditions; the quality of the laser radiation; the energy characteristics of the laser system; and the precision in positioning the laser focus.
